"Reboot and select proper boot device, or insert boot media in selected boot device and press any key" Primary boot device is set to the DVDRW drive, DVDRW is Primary Master. Will not boot from CD and let me install windows. However popping my motherboard CD in lets it boot from cd and it wants me to make a boot disk?! However I do not have a floppy drive. Why wont it JUST boot from the Windows XP CD, I didn't have this problem with my old pc, I just popped the CD in straight away and it let me install!!! Please help! System is: ASUS® A8R-MVP: DUAL DDR, S-ATA, 2 x x16 VGA, 3 PCI Motherboard SATA II 160 GB HARD DISK |

This sounds like you have a dvd-rw and a cdrom drive. The bios always looks to the primary drive to boot from. Since dvd-rw's can also read CD's , have you tried putting the XP cd in the dvd-rw and see if it will start installing? You may also have to load drivers for the sata drive for windows to see it to install.
